Transaction 74580aaab93903de42ca6eda274ddcd33b74e01eef811f6b9cad40ad30fda0c4

block
6d21f99938b28a5491407d0bd250b11b42dcac48a690485c4df2428406ed6001

1 Input

2 Outputs